79607 can be classified socioeconomically as Lower Middle Class class compared to other ZIP Codes in Texas based on Median Household Income and Average Adjusted Gross Income. The majority race/ethnicity residing in 79607 is White. The majority race/ethnicity attending public schools in 79607 is White. The current unemployment level in 79607 is 3.7%.
